Housing Affordability Trust awards $4.3 million to Alabama nonprofits

The Birmingham-based Housing Affordability Trust (HAT) approved $4.3 million in grants to nearly 40 organizations across Alabama. The 2026 funding round supports initiatives supporting:

  • Affordable housing development
  • Food security
  • Clean water access
  • Workforce development
  • Family stabilization services

Funding affordable housing and community support in Alabama

HAT’s mission focuses on addressing multiple root causes of community instability. By funding a diverse mix of nonprofits, the trust aims to provide comprehensive support alongside transitional and permanent housing.

One recipient in this round of grants is Girls Inc. of Central Alabama, which provides academic support, mentorship and enrichment programs for young girls in the region.
